Veronica Hartley

Consultant

Veronica Hartley is a corporate and commercial lawyer passionate about all things environmental. Throughout her practice, she has been active in green businesses and is a forceful advocate for change. In 2019, Veronica changed her focus to assisting organisations, community groups and businesses dealing with environmental legal issues.

As a lawyer who has spent more than ten years advising clients operating across a broad range of industry sectors, as well as drawing on the management experience she gained as head of the Corporate and Commercial Team in London, Veronica intends to build a bespoke practice focusing on the environment and climate change, with the ultimate aim of making a difference.

Veronica Hartley’s experience working with a wide range of clients, including financial institutions, national and international body corporates, SMEs, start-ups, entrepreneurs, JV parties, partnerships and LLPs and investors, places her in an ideal position to engage with the business world in making a difference on climate change and help environmental organisations achieve their goals in practical ways extending beyond the limited confines of politics.

“For some time I’ve wanted to refocus my career to explore ways RIAA Barker Gillette can not only assist our highly valued corporate clients but also have a positive social impact. This is a chance for us to use our skills not only to protect the environment but achieve access to justice for all those dealing with challenging environmental problems.”
